five hundred fifty-nine million, nine hundred ninety-eight thousand, two hundred thirty-six
貨幣$559998236 英文: five hundred fifty-nine million, nine hundred ninety-eight thousand, two hundred thirty-six US Dollars.
價格: 559998236.00
549998236 | 569998236